Shawn Letton
Shawn Letton
Peaks League/Snowboarding/Freestyle Program Director
Shawn started to ski at the age of six at the London Ski Club. Despite the fact that you could ski the runs in London top to bottom in 15 seconds, Shawn worked his way through the Ski School Programs and on to his Level 1 Instructor at age 16. Shawn continued to instruct skiing through his high school and college years but at age 19, he switched to a snowboard after realizing they were actually building jumps for snowboarders.
By 20, Shawn was teaching snowboarding full time and spent one season in London and then made the move to Blue Mountain. After two full seasons at Blue and after completing his Level 2, Shawn made the move to Georgian Peaks as the Snowboard Supervisor. Over the last six seasons at the Peaks, Shawn has continued to evolve with the Club. Shawn began running a successful Freestyle Ski Program and has looked after the Peaks League programs for the past seasons.
Shawn's certification levels include Level 3 Snowboard Instructor, Level 1 Freestyle Instructor, Race and Evaluator for Snowboarding. On the ski side, Shawn is a Level 1 Instructor and a Level 1 Freestyle Instructor.
In the off season, Shawn spent five seasons traveling between the Peaks, Whistler and New Zealand to maximize his time on snow.
Last summer he bought a place in Collingwood. He currently spends his summers putting together the competitive events for Freestyle Ski Ontario were he runs park and pipe, ski cross and mogul events for the Province. Off snow, Shawn spends his time mountain biking, golfing, rock climbing and at the gym.
